Prince Harry's title has been changed on Royal Family's website.

Prince Harry’s title of 'His Royal Highness' (HRH) has been officially removed from the Royal Family's website three years after he stepped down from the royal duties.

The Duke of Sussex stepped back from his royal duties alongside his wife Meghan Markle in 2020.

The update on the website comes days after the Express reported that Prince Harry was still being referred to by his HRH title in a bio on the website. The references, which were linked to Harry’s work to raise awareness around HIV/AIDS in 2016 as reported by People, have now been updated to refer to him as “the duke” or “the Duke of Sussex”.

The update was part of a broader revision of the website following the death of Queen Elizabeth II. The site now reflects the current titles of King Charles III and Queen Camilla, previously known as the Prince of Wales and Duchess of Cornwall. Similarly, Prince William and Kate Middleton's titles have been updated to the Prince and Princess of Wales.

The Palace stated that the website, containing over five thousand pages of information about the Royal Family, is being updated periodically following the Queen's passing. Some content may remain outdated until the process is complete.

Harry and Meghan gave up their HRH titles along with their decision to step back from their roles as senior royals.

Interestingly, the titles of Harry and Meghan's children, Archie and Lilibet, were updated on the royal website earlier this year. Previously referred to as "Master Archie Mountbatten-Windsor" and "Miss Lilibet Mountbatten-Windsor", they are now recognised as prince and princess following King Charles' ascension to the throne.
